A double pane window is a two glass panes that are separated by a gap that is filled with air or other insulating gases like argon. If the windows start to become cloudy it means that the seal is failing and the window has to be replaced.

Mistaken Windows

Double glazing can be an excellent way to cut down on the cost of energy and keeping the heat in your home however, it can also be susceptible to misting. If you notice condensation on the exterior and inside of your windows, it's a sign that the seals have failed and require replacement. If not taken care of this could lead to your home becoming damp and unhealthy.

Condensation is caused by warm air coming in contact with cold and impermeable surfaces such as windows. It happens because humidity is attracted to cooler air and then forms on the surface of windows. This can lead to an accumulation of fogging and misting on the inside of your windows and make it difficult to see through them.

One of the most common causes for a double-glazed window to fail is the accumulation of moisture within the glass panes. In windows, moisture accumulation can cause a number of issues like rusting and water leakage. A window that leaks could cause mold to spread throughout your home. If left untreated, mold could eventually destroy the structure of your home. It is crucial to have your windows repaired immediately to save yourself from costly repairs in the future.

A double-glazed window consists of two glass panes, separated by a spacer bar. The gap is filled with non-conductive gas, such as Argon to create a barrier that will prevent cold air from entering your home and warm air from leaving. This allows you to maintain an even temperature throughout your home and avoid loss of heat. The window is then sealed around the edges to create an airtight seal and increase insulation.

Many who have purchased double glazing have issues with their door or window mechanisms, but they can be fixed. Usually, it's a case of oiling the hinges, mechanism or any other places that pass through the frame (if they are windows made of sash) to check if it solves the issue.

If you have a window with a blown-out seal, this means that moisture is getting in between the glass panes. This can lead to condensation or draughts, and can even let outside air into your home. It is recommended to repair it as quickly as you can, because a leaky window could increase your heating or cooling costs by up to 20 percent every year.

A window replacement is regarded as a 'controlled fitting' under Building Regulations and you will need to follow the regulations to ensure that the new windows are in line with the insulation standards. You should employ a certified glazier to ensure the job is done correctly and the regulations are followed.
